I knew it would just be a matter of time but it seems that the blog spammers finally found me. When I checked my site today I noticed at least 2 comments on every single post in my blog. They were all for online casinos. Spammers really are ruining the internet. Damn they are annoying!
So to fix the problem I got MT-BlackList. It's a pretty simple little plugin for Movable Type that will not only de-spam your comments on request, but it also blocks spammers from ever posting to your site. It's pretty damn good too. It's written in Perl and uses regular expressions and a black list (of course) to do the filtering. I definitely recommend it to anyone that is having spam related troubles with their blog.
